Discover the Vibrant Charm of Lancaster, California: A Place to Thrive

Life in Lancaster, California, blends the warmth of community spirit with opportunities for adventure and growth. Situated in the heart of the Antelope Valley, this dynamic city promises a fulfilling way of life, exuding an energy that embraces both residents and visitors alike.

Lancaster prides itself on a robust artistic and cultural scene. At its core is the Lancaster Museum of Art and History, a testament to the city's commitment to the arts, where contemporary and historical exhibits come together to inspire creativity. The recently revitalized downtown boulevard is a hub of activity, offering eclectic shops, tempting eateries, and local festivities that bring the community together all year round.

Nature enthusiasts will find solace in the scenic surroundings of the Antelope Valley. The captivating poppy fields at the Antelope Valley California Poppy Reserve offer stunning vistas that usher in spring's blooming beauty, while the adventure-seekers can explore endless trails and outdoor activities.

Lancaster is more than just a city; it's a place where innovation meets tradition. With renewable energy efforts like the Solar Lancaster initiative leading the charge, it's committed to a sustainable future. Residents here thrive in a community dedicated to progress, making Lancaster not only a place to live but a place to love.

Workforce & Industrial Development

Located in northern Los Angeles County, Lancaster, California is rapidly establishing itself as a center for aerospace, advanced manufacturing, and green technology industries. Its strategic position along State Route 14 and proximity to both the Los Angeles basin and Mojave Desert test ranges make it a prime location for logistics and industrial operations.

Lancaster’s industrial market is seeing robust activity, with new developments and expansions by aerospace giants and renewable energy firms. The city’s Advanced Manufacturing and Innovation Corridor is attracting significant investment, offering modern facilities and shovel-ready sites for a range of industrial users.

The city actively supports workforce development through partnerships with Antelope Valley College and the Antelope Valley Workforce Development Board, providing tailored training in aerospace, engineering, and skilled trades. Local programs are designed to align with employer needs, helping companies quickly ramp up operations with qualified talent.

California’s incentive landscape includes targeted tax credits, sales/use tax exclusions, and workforce training grants, while the City of Lancaster offers fast-track permitting and site selection assistance. Regional collaboration with the Greater Antelope Valley Economic Alliance further enhances support for relocating or expanding businesses.
